Health Systems

Over 100 years ago, the Seventh-day Adventist Church shifted from a focus on illness to a focus on wholistic healthcare that embraced physical, mental, and spiritual health and healing. Today there are a number of healthcare systems that operate hundreds of facilities. Adventists have two healthcare organizations in the Columbia Union—Adventist Health Care, headquartered in Rockville, Md.; and Kettering Adventist HealthCare, based in Dayton, Ohio. Following the example of Jesus, these organizations provide ministries of healing to thousands every day at nearly 100 facilities in three states.
